Peugeot 408 is substantially cheaper – starting at 35,100 £ , while the Hyundai Nexo costs 59,900 £ . That’s a price difference of around 24,797 £.
Under the bonnet, it becomes clear which model is tuned for sportiness and which one takes the lead when you hit the accelerator.
When it comes to engine power, the Peugeot 408 offers moderately more power – delivering 240 HP compared to 204 HP. That’s roughly 36 HP more horsepower.
When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the Peugeot 408 is very slightly quicker – completing the sprint in 7.2 s, while the Hyundai Nexo takes 7.8 s. That’s about 0.6 s quicker.
There’s also a difference in torque: the Peugeot 408 delivers very slightly more torque with 360 Nm compared to 350 Nm. That’s about 10 Nm more.
Beyond pure performance, interior space and usability matter most in daily life. This is where you see which car is more practical and versatile.
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.
In terms of curb weight, Peugeot 408 is visibly lighter – 1,544 kg compared to 1,955 kg. The difference is around 411 kg.
When it comes to payload, the Hyundai Nexo carries only slightly more – 485 kg compared to 456 kg. That’s a difference of about 29 kg.

Hyundai Nexo looks like a quietly futuristic family car, gliding along with whisper-quiet refinement and a cabin that keeps long commutes pleasant. As a hydrogen-powered cruiser it delivers genuinely clean driving and a practical, slightly exotic alternative for buyers who want something clever without the fuss.
detailsThe Peugeot 408 blends a coupe-like roofline with practical sensibility, delivering striking looks and a surprisingly airy, premium-feeling cabin. On the road it prefers comfort and poise over manic thrills, making it a smart, stylish choice for buyers who want something a bit different from the usual family hatchback.
